Logo Image — specify an optional jpg, gif, or png file to display at the top
of the page.
Header Text File — specify an optional .txt file to display at the top of the
page (beneath the logo, if any).
Footer Text File — specify an optional .txt file to display at the bottom of
the page.
Whitelist Configuration for Web Page Redirect
On a per-SSID basis, the whitelist allows you to specify Internet destinations that
stations can access without first having to pass the WPR login/splash page. Note
that a whitelist may be specified for a user group as well. See “Group
Management” on page 271.
Figure 142. Whitelist Configuration for WPR
To add a web site to the whitelist for this SSID, enter it in the provided field, then
click Create. You may enter an IP address or a domain name. Up to 32 entries may
be created.
Example whitelist entries:
Hostname: www.yahoo.com (but not www.yahoo.com/abc/def.html)
Wildcards are supported: *.yahoo.com
IP address: 121.122.123.124
Some typical applications for this feature are:
to add allowed links to the WPR page
to add a link to terms of use that may be hosted on another site
to allow embedded video on WPR page
